The clock speed of the 8085 depends on the particular chip chosen. The basic 8085 could run up to around 3 MHz. The -1 version could run up to around 6 MHz. The -2 version could run up to around 5 MHz.

In each case, the crystal frequency had to be exactly twice the desired clock frequency, i.e. 6 Mhz, 12 MHz, and 10 MHz, respectively.

In all cases, the minimum clock frequency was 500 KHz. (Crystal 1 MHz)

What is the function of READY pin of 8085?

The READY pin on the 8085 microprocessor is used to delay the completion of a bus transfer cycle. It is sampled by the 8085 at the falling edge of clock following ALE. If it is high, the cycle completes. If it is low, the cycle is extended by one clock, with all lines held steady - then it is sampled again at each of the next falling edges of clock until it is high. The purpose of READY is to allow (usually) memory devices to operate at a slower speed than the 8085.

Specify the crystal frequency required for an 8085 system to operate at 1.1mhz?

The crystal frquency in an 8085 system is twice the desired clock frequency, so a crystal of 2.2 MHz is required to operate at 1.1 MHz.Note: Clock frequency is not the same as instructions per second, because the instructions in an 8085 take a variable number of clock cycles, between 4 and 18, to execute.

Give the clock out frequency and state time T of 8085 when the crystal frequencies is 5MHz?

The clock out frequency of an 8085 is one half the crystal frequency. The period of one T cycle is the inverse of the clock frequency. At a crystal frequency of 5MHz, the clock is 2.5MHz, and T is 400 ns.

What no of instruction will be execute by using only one clock pulse in 8085 microprocessor?

There are no instructions in the 8085 that execute in only one clock pulse. The minimum number of clock cycles is four; three for instruction fetch and one for instruction decode/execute.


What is t state in 8085 microprocessor?

A T state is one cycle of the system clock.


When trap interrupt line is checked by 8085 microprocessor?

In the 8085, trap, intr, and rstx.5 lines are checked on the falling edge of clock, at the beginning of the last T cycle of an instruction, or approximately one clock cycle before ALE.
